Position Purpose:

The Corporate/M&A Counsel reports directly to the SVP & Associate General Counsel – Corporate/M&A and Canada and requires an attorney with legal knowledge in strategic transactions and corporate functions, as well as a demonstrated ability to lead cross-functional teams and support senior management in achieving business goals.

The purpose of this role is to lead the company’s legal practice with respect to mergers, acquisitions, divestitures and strategic investments; to ensure the company’s compliance with its formation documents, including with respect to board of directors functions, shareholder approvals, and related party transactions; to manage the company’s compliance with its debt covenants and other financing obligations.

Primary Duties/Responsibilities:

Assist the Legal Department’s mergers, acquisitions, and investments practice, including negotiating and drafting (or overseeing the drafting of) term sheets and definitive deal documents.

Manage the Company’s diligence and disclosure processes, both with respect to company acquisitions and potential new investments in the company.

Ensure compliance with applicable laws, regulations, and covenants with respect to the Company’s debt, including advising on disclosures.

Ensure compliance with corporate obligations and applicable regulations, such as Board of Directors functions, shareholder approvals and related party transactions.

Work cooperatively and productively with the Company’s finance team, business development team, and other company personnel to ensure efficient, effective deal structures and compliant disclosures.

Assume a leadership role in communicating and negotiating with external parties (e.g., regulators, external counsel, and public authorities), creating relations of trust.

Maintain an investment playbook to guide company personnel and advisors in mergers, acquisitions and strategic investments, and a brief instructional sheet on required board, shareholder, and related party approvals for use by company personnel.

Research and evaluate risk factors regarding business decisions and operations.

Apply effective risk management techniques and offer proactive advice on possible legal issues.

Remain current in evolving legal standards and business structures regarding the foregoing responsibilities.

Qualifications:

Education/Experience/Background:

Juris Doctor Degree from a nationally recognized law school.

10+ years in a major law firm or complex corporate environment, with substantive transactional experience and corporate governance experience.

Prior experience as in-house counsel preferred.

Experience with regulatory matters preferred.

Knowledge/Skills/Abilities:

Outstanding written and verbal communication skills.

Outstanding skills leading negotiations and drafting documentation for sophisticated commercial transactions, including credit documentation, acquisition and joint venture agreements, construction contracts, and complex service and outsourcing contracts.

Ability to work with minimal supervision on time-sensitive projects while executing transactions and projects.

Ability to lead cross-functional teams in a fast-paced environment.

Significant experience supporting operations or a P&L line of business.

Significant experience working with senior business leaders and boards of directors.

Excellent interpersonal skills with ability to interface with internal and external stakeholders.

Ability to contribute to Legal Department as a team player.

Required Certification/Licenses/Training:

Licensed to practice law and bar member in good standing.
